> _Context & purpose_
> We 're using this to improve SPDK performance. When NVMe completion
> queues are allocated from a certain memory range,
> out of order competions completions are enabled with our PCIe and it
> improves performance.
>
> _Usage_
> spdk_env_init()-->(calls rte_eal_init(), and then calls
> )spdk_env_dpdk_post_init() [file: spdk/lib/env_dpdk/init.c]
> --> spdk_mem_map_init()
> [lib/env_dpdk/memory.c]-->map_cmem_virtual_area() [this is our custom
> function]
> In map_cmem_virtual_area(): we 're mmaping anonymous & private region
> and then creating iova table which makes iova addresses which fall in
> custom memory region.
> Then we call rte_malloc_heap_memory_add() and then allocate NVMe
> completion queues from this heap.
